JP Discussion Fun Lore Fact about the New Ex Spoiler

Post image
45 Upvotes

Her title translate to “Great Ice Spirit”, this is in reference to the face Cirno was not intended to be a fairy when EoSD was created, as her title in JP calls her a spirit instead of a fairy.

This is also why her name is so different compared to all the other named fairies and why Daiyousei’s real name is theorized to be “Lunate Elf”.

IceFairy on Twitter did a great thread about this, but that is what the inspiration behind EX Cirno is. (Personally don’t like the execution but ehh)

JP Discussion Good news for Aya fans as we got a new 2nd strongest Relic character Spoiler

Thumbnail gallery
42 Upvotes

This character is like... really good for some reason. Basically she buffs everything that you'd want across the board with high lw dmg and 7 breaks. -2 cd reduce for everyone is pretty insane for a good sum of characters and opens the door to a lot of silly things. Her flaws (most notably: she wants to conserve the second use of her first skill for g2 so she can spam breaks even better, but can't on her own due to p issues) aren't even that hard to solve with good pairing (using her with new years reisen kinda makes things fall apart) or if using her in any stage that inflicts elements she absorbs. Though she's not perfect of course (dmg to eff issues, subpar AoE killers, lacking innate debuffs, wants more Acc buffs), she's quite notably good, big W for aya fans

JP Discussion NEW JP UNIT ANALYSIS POST Spoiler

Thumbnail gallery
56 Upvotes

Concert Sucks-uya

Tl;dr: Buffs are alright, she does focus on crit related buffs a lot though. Setup feels noticeably worse due to the fact she has no debuffs AND no acc (assuming you don't set her anoms up). Her s3 is essentially a worse genic reso: 10% more crit damage + 5% more for each concert unit (base 15% vs 20% of goatgetsu and mima); has 2 lvls of crit ii to party on lw which is nice all things considered. Most recent units get around the same level of buffs and gimmicks if not better, all while not having nearly as much flaws...

LW damage does seem promising even with her scaling; SCs have garbage scaling and only 1 dest line which overlap with killer lines, speaking of killers, they are hot garbage. So far, she seems to share a niche with units like c3 sakuya and blue2 - deleting gauge 2 and when using gimmicks to make nuking gauge 3 easier. Though compared to the two units I've just mentioned, sucksuya does get the short end of the stick, sadly. Really held back from being a relevant unit from all the weirdness in her kit, main offender here are the killers. At the very least, she is shillable.
